Default MS Forms 2.0 Object Library

I have a macro that runs in excel. It merges data from an excel worksheet
into a word doc. It runs once in awhile. I'm a beginner and decided to play
around with the references. I checked MS Forms 2.0 Object Library. Now I
can't get it unchecked and have copied the macro into a different workbook
that doesn't have that reference checked and it runs just fine. Is there a
way to get that off of my reference list?

Default MS Forms 2.0 Object Library

Do you have a userform in that workbook or controls from the control toolbox ?
If you do you need the reference
